12. Mosla formosana Maximowicz, Bull. Acad. Imp. Sci. Saint-Pétersbourg. 20: 459. 1875.

台湾荠苎 tai wan qi zhu

Mosla lysimachiiflora Hayata; Orthodon formosanus (Maximowicz) Kudo; O. lysimachiiflorus (Hayata) Masamune.

Stems erect, branched, subglabrous. Petiole 3-12 mm, adaxially slightly scaly puberulent; leaf blade ovate to ovate-lanceolate, 1.5-3 × 0.7-1.5 cm, subglabrous, abaxially sparsely impressed glandular, base broadly cuneate, margin crenate-serrate, apex obtuse to acute. Racemes 3-9 cm, finely puberulent; bracts lanceolate, 1.5-2.5 mm, subglabrous, apex acute. Pedicel 1.5-2.5 mm. Calyx ca. 2 × 2 mm, dilated to ca. 5 × 3 mm in fruit, sparsely fine glandular hairy, veins finely pilose; upper teeth triangular, obtuse, middle tooth shorter. Corolla ca. 5 mm, puberulent, without hairy annulus inside, upper lip straight. Style exserted. Nutlets yellow-brown, ovoid, ca. 1 mm, loosely netted, areolae indistinct. Fl. and fr. Oct.

Taiwan [Philippines].
